CVE-2021-3467
CVE-2021-3467 is a NULL pointer dereference in Jasper’s JP2 image format decoder when handling component references in the JP2 CDEF box. The vulnerability of the image conversion module from TIFF to RGBA format in the LibTIFF library allows a hacker to induce a service failure.
The vulnerability of the TIFF-to-RGBA tiff2rgba conversion module in the LibTIFF library is related to the execution of operations outside of the buffer boundaries in memory. UBUNTU-CVE-2021-20240
A flaw was found in gdk-pixbuf in versions before 2.42.0. An integer wraparound leading to an out of bounds write can occur when a crafted GIF image is loaded. An attacker may cause applications to crash or could potentially execute code on the victim system. The highest threat from this...
